The journey from Englewood to Richmond is about 1,700 miles. Flying from Denver International Airport to Richmond International Airport takes about 4 hours. Driving is a 25-hour trip via I-70 and I-64. Richmond is a historic city with a vibrant arts scene, beautiful architecture, and a rich Civil War history. It is a city with a unique blend of old and new.
